Should a bathroom be a light or dark color?

Generally people choose lighter colors for a bathroom because they feel it makes the space appear larger. The truth is, the more monochromatic a room is, the larger it appears. And the more variation in color from wall to floor, trim and tile color, the smaller the room will seem.

Why are most toilets white?

Toilets are white for several reasons. They are mostly made out of porcelain, and porcelain itself is white. White also represents cleanliness, and it makes it easy to see dirt. White toilets are also cheaper than colored toilets, and they provide a modern aesthetic.

What color makes a bathroom look bigger?

So what colors make a bathroom look bigger? According to basic design principles, light colors such as white, crème, pastel blue, gray or yellow will visually expand a room, while dark colors such as a deep red, green or brown, will make a room feel smaller.

Is soft white or daylight better for bathroom?

Soft White or Daylight for Bathrooms

In most bathroom or vanity applications, you want a brighter light. A preferable color temperature for a bathroom is 3000K (soft-white) to 5000K (cool white). Daylight can be too blue and sterile, so I like to err on the side of soft white to cool white.

Is cool white good for bathroom?

Cool white lighting has a white output with a small tint of blue depending on the amount of kelvins. This lighting is often used in modern bathrooms and kitchens where precise, task lighting such as cooking, cleaning, grooming and applying makeup is at a higher demand.
